What Are the Key Features to Look for in the Best Sport Dog Harness?

When searching for the best sport dog harness, consider the following key features:

  • Adjustability: A good harness should have multiple adjustment points to ensure a snug and comfortable fit for your dog. This allows for a customized fit that accommodates your dog’s body shape and size, preventing chafing or slipping during physical activities.
  • Durability: The materials used in the harness should be robust and withstand the rigors of active sports and outdoor activities. Look for harnesses made from high-quality fabrics that are resistant to wear and tear, as well as strong stitching that can endure pulling and rough use.
  • Comfort Padding: This feature enhances your dog’s comfort, especially during extended wear. A harness with padded straps or a padded chest plate helps distribute pressure evenly and reduces the risk of injury or discomfort while your dog is active.
  • Reflective Materials: Safety is paramount, particularly in low-light conditions. Harnesses with reflective strips or materials increase visibility, making it easier for you to spot your dog during evening walks or in dim environments.
  • Leash Attachment Options: The best sport dog harnesses should offer multiple leash attachment points, typically on the back and sometimes on the front. This versatility allows for various walking styles and can aid in training by discouraging pulling behavior.
  • Lightweight Design: A harness should be lightweight to avoid adding unnecessary weight during physical activities. A lightweight design ensures that your dog can run, jump, and play freely without feeling burdened.
  • Easy to Put On and Take Off: A sport harness should be user-friendly, allowing for quick and easy application. Look for designs that feature clips or buckles that are simple to operate, making the process of getting your dog ready for an adventure hassle-free.

How Do Different Types of Sport Dog Harnesses Cater to Specific Activities?

Different types of sport dog harnesses are designed to enhance performance and comfort for specific activities.

  • Pulling Harness: This type is specifically designed for dogs that engage in pulling sports, such as sledding or carting. It distributes the load across the dog’s body, allowing them to pull without causing strain or injury, ensuring they can perform efficiently during competitions.
  • Agility Harness: An agility harness is lightweight and allows for maximum freedom of movement, which is crucial for navigating courses quickly. It typically features a secure fit and minimal bulk, so dogs can jump, weave, and sprint without any hindrance.
  • Tracking Harness: Designed for scent work and tracking activities, this harness provides a comfortable fit that allows the dog to focus on scenting without distraction. It often includes attachment points for leashes and is built to withstand various terrains, ensuring durability during long tracking sessions.
  • Service Dog Harness: While often used in sporting contexts, service dog harnesses are designed for specific tasks such as mobility assistance or medical alert. These harnesses usually come with added features like reflective strips, identification patches, and handles for better control, making them versatile for both sport and service work.
  • Rally Obedience Harness: This harness offers comfort and control for dogs participating in rally obedience competitions. It is designed to allow easy attachment of a leash and provides a secure fit that keeps the dog focused on the handler’s commands while moving through the course.
  • Flyball Harness: Flyball harnesses are built for speed and quick movements, allowing dogs to sprint back and forth in a relay race format. These harnesses often have adjustable straps for a snug fit, which helps prevent any chance of slipping during fast-paced action.
  • Canoeing or Kayaking Harness: Specifically designed for water sports, these harnesses often feature buoyancy and quick-dry materials. They provide safety and control while keeping the dog secure during water activities, making it easier for owners to manage their dogs in a vessel.

What Are the Benefits of Using a Front-Clip Harness for Running and Hiking?

The benefits of using a front-clip harness for running and hiking with your dog include improved control, increased safety, and enhanced comfort.

  • Improved Control: A front-clip harness allows for better steering and control of your dog, especially during high-energy activities like running or hiking. This design minimizes pulling by redirecting your dog’s movement towards you, making it easier to manage their pace and direction.
  • Increased Safety: These harnesses reduce the risk of escape and injury, as they distribute pressure evenly across the chest rather than the neck. This is particularly important during outdoor activities where sudden movements or distractions can lead to accidents.
  • Enhanced Comfort: A front-clip harness is often designed with padded straps and an ergonomic fit, ensuring that your dog remains comfortable during long runs or hikes. This comfort encourages your dog to participate actively without the risk of chafing or discomfort.
  • Versatility: Front-clip harnesses can be used for a variety of activities beyond running and hiking, including training and casual walks. This adaptability makes them a practical choice for dog owners who engage in multiple outdoor pursuits.
  • Positive Training Tool: Using a front-clip harness can aid in training by promoting positive reinforcement techniques. As it helps reduce pulling, it encourages dogs to focus on their handler, making it an effective tool for teaching good leash manners.

How Do You Determine the Right Size and Fit for Your Dog?

To determine the right size and fit for your dog when selecting the best sport dog harness, consider the following factors:

  • Measure Your Dog’s Chest and Neck: Accurate measurements are crucial for finding a harness that fits well. Use a soft measuring tape to measure around the widest part of your dog’s chest and the circumference of the neck, as different harnesses may have specific sizing guidelines based on these measurements.
  • Consider Your Dog’s Weight and Breed: Different breeds and sizes have different body shapes, which can affect how a harness fits. Check the manufacturer’s sizing chart that correlates with your dog’s weight and breed to find the most suitable option for them.
  • Evaluate the Harness Style: There are various harness styles such as front-clip, back-clip, and no-pull designs. Each style can affect how the harness fits and functions during activities, so choose one that aligns with your dog’s behavior and the intended use, whether it’s for training, running, or casual walks.
  • Check for Adjustability: A good sport dog harness should have adjustable straps to accommodate your dog’s unique body shape. Look for harnesses with multiple points of adjustment, allowing you to customize the fit for comfort and security.
  • Test for Comfort and Movement: Once fitted, ensure that the harness allows for free movement without chafing or restricting your dog. Have your dog walk around while wearing the harness to observe how it fits and to ensure it doesn’t rub against sensitive areas.

Which Materials Are Most Suitable for Sport Dog Harnesses?

The materials most suitable for sport dog harnesses include:

  • Nylon: Nylon is a popular choice for sport dog harnesses due to its strength and durability. It is resistant to wear and tear, making it ideal for active dogs that are frequently involved in rigorous activities.
  • Polyester: Polyester is another excellent material that offers UV resistance, ensuring that the harness maintains its color and integrity even when exposed to sunlight. It is lightweight and breathable, which is essential for comfort during physical exertion.
  • Neoprene: Neoprene is often used for padding in sport dog harnesses because it provides cushioning and comfort for the dog. Its water-resistant properties also make it suitable for wet conditions, ensuring that the harness remains functional and does not absorb moisture.
  • Reflective materials: Incorporating reflective materials into a sport dog harness enhances visibility during low-light conditions, such as early mornings or late evenings. This added safety feature is crucial for keeping both the dog and owner visible to others while exercising outdoors.
  • Mesh fabric: Mesh fabric is ideal for harnesses that require breathability, allowing for better air circulation around the dog’s body. This helps to prevent overheating during intense activities, making it a wise choice for warmer climates or long exercise sessions.
